What’s Wrong with Traditional Solar Solutions?
Look, it’s simpler than you think! Many homeowners underestimate the importance of tech specs like power converters and edge computing nodes when choosing solar systems. Traditional solar panels often struggle with efficiency under low-light conditions or have a reduced performance in hot weather—a real pain point that can lead to frustration after installation. Some users end up facing disappointing energy outputs just when they need it most. It’s like buying a high-performance car but only using it for city driving. When it comes to rooftop solar, understanding these flaws is vital for making informed decisions.
What to Look Out For?
Understanding these issues leads us to find promising alternatives. N-Type solar panels, for example, leverage innovative designs to tackle these traditional pitfalls. These panels maintain performance even under low light and require less maintenance compared to their predecessors. Plus, they’re better equipped for BAPV scenarios, enabling seamless integration with your existing structure without sacrificing aesthetics. It’s a win-win—who wouldn’t want that?
